AI Analysis
Raw output from both teams looks comparable at first glance, yet once we account for Strength of Schedule, a clear hierarchy emerges. The favorite has repeatedly risen to the challenge against higher-caliber opponents, underlining a genuine quality advantage.
Context matters here: Rennes's schedule strength (SoS: 76.6) has been notably more demanding than Nice's (SoS: 43.7), meaning their underlying stats reflect performance against higher-calibre opposition and should be weighted accordingly.
Rennes leads the attacking statistics, averaging 2.1 goals per game compared to Nice's 1.7 — a meaningful but far from decisive advantage.
Nice's backline outperforms Rennes's, with 0.8 goals conceded per match versus 1.5.
Rennes has an exceptional home record with a 83% win rate at their home ground. When playing at home, they become significantly more dangerous.
Statistical modeling projects 3.0 goals in this fixture. The data points Over 2.5 as the value threshold, while BTTS stands at likely based on both sides' scoring records.
🔥 Form Momentum: Rennes is in scorching form, winning 7 of their last 10 matches with 21 goals scored. This level of consistency is difficult to sustain but devastating while it lasts.
📈 Form Momentum: Nice has been remarkably consistent, maintaining a steady 1.6 points per game over their last 10 matches. This stability makes them a predictable but reliable force.
📊 Key Trend: The form trajectories are diverging. Rennes is on the rise with 7W in last 10, while Nice shows signs of decline with 4W in last 10.
⚠️ Risk Factor: Despite being the statistical favorite, Rennes faces a key vulnerability: their defense concedes 1.5 goals per match. If Nice can exploit this, an upset becomes plausible.
💡 Why This Matters: The 24.1-point power rating gap between these teams translates to approximately a 85% win probability for Rennes. In practical terms, Rennes would win 8 out of 10 such matchups.
Based on the available data, Rennes holds the stronger position heading into this matchup. A power rating of 77.0 against 52.9 underlines their overall quality advantage and makes them the logical pick to come out on top.

Comparison Summary
This head-to-head comparison analyzes the last 10 matches of each team, evaluating attack power, defensive strength, form consistency, and overall performance metrics. The power ratings are calculated using a weighted algorithm that considers goals scored, goals conceded, win rate, and recent form trends.
Rennes
7W 1D 2L · 21 goals scored · 15 conceded
Nice
4W 4D 2L · 17 goals scored · 8 conceded
